What to Look for in a Robot Vacuum and Mop
Before diving into the top picks, it’s necessary to comprehend the key functions to think about when picking a robot vacuum and mop:

- Suction Power: The suction power determines how efficiently the robot can pick up dirt and particles. Look for designs with at least 2000Pa of suction power for optimal efficiency.
- Battery Life: A longer battery life suggests the robot can clean larger locations without requiring to charge. Go for a battery that lasts a minimum of 1.5 to 2 hours.
- Navigation Technology: Advanced navigation systems, such as L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) or VSLAM (Visual Simultaneous Localization and Mapping), ensure the robot can map your home accurately and avoid obstacles.
- Cleaning Modes: Different cleaning modes, such as edge cleaning, area cleaning, and set up cleaning, provide versatility and efficiency.
- App Integration: An easy to use app allows you to manage the robot, set cleaning schedules, and monitor its performance from your smart device.
- Tank Capacity: Larger dust and water tanks lower the frequency of emptying and filling up, making the cleaning process more convenient.
- Noise Level: Opt for models with low sound levels to avoid interrupting your day-to-day activities.
- Consumer Support: Reliable consumer support is crucial in case you experience any issues or have questions.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Are robot vacuums and mops appropriate for homes with pets?
- A1: Yes, many robot vacuums and mops are created to manage pet hair and dander efficiently. Try to find designs with strong suction power and specialized pet cleaning modes.
Q2: Can robot vacuums and mops clean up all types of floorings?
- A2: Most robot vacuums and mops are versatile and can clean up numerous floor types, including hardwood, tile, and carpet. Nevertheless, some models might carry out much better on particular surface areas. Examine the maker’s specs for the best results.
Q3: How frequently should I clean the robot vacuum and mop?
- A3: It’s recommended to empty the dustbin and tidy the filters after each use. The water tank and mopping pads need to be cleaned and changed regularly to maintain hygiene and performance.
Q4: Can I manage the robot vacuum and mop with voice commands?
- A4: Yes, lots of models work with smart home assistants like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ant, allowing you to control them with voice commands.
Q5: Are robot vacuums and mops energy-efficient?
- A5: Generally, robot vacuums and mops are developed to be energy-efficient, with the majority of designs using less power than traditional vacuum. However, battery life and energy intake can differ in between designs.
